What is a Lithium-Ion Battery?

A lithium-ion battery (Li-ion) is a type of rechargeable battery that uses lithium ions as the primary component of its electrochemistry. This battery operates on the principle of lithium ions moving from the negative electrode to the positive electrode during discharge and vice versa during charging. The fundamental components of a lithium-ion battery include an anode (typically made of graphite), a cathode (often a lithium metal oxide), a separator, and an electrolyte.

How Do Lithium-Ion Batteries Work?

The operation of lithium-ion batteries is based on ion exchange. During discharge, lithium ions move from the anode to the cathode, generating an electric current that can be harnessed to power devices. When charging, the process is reversed: lithium ions travel back to the anode. This cyclical movement of ions is what makes lithium-ion batteries suitable for rechargeable applications.

Advantages of Lithium-Ion Batteries

  • High Energy Density: One of the most notable advantages of lithium-ion batteries is their high energy density. This means they can store a significant amount of energy in a relatively small and lightweight package, making them ideal for portable electronic devices and electric vehicles.
  • Low Self-Discharge Rate: Lithium-ion batteries have a low self-discharge rate compared to other rechargeable batteries, which means they can hold their charge for an extended period. This characteristic is crucial for devices that may not be used frequently.
  • Long Cycle Life: With proper care and usage, lithium-ion batteries can last for many charge-discharge cycles, offering a longer lifespan than other battery technologies.
  • Fast Charging Capabilities: Many lithium-ion batteries support rapid charging, allowing users to recharge their devices quickly and efficiently.

Disadvantages of Lithium-Ion Batteries

  • Cost: The production of lithium-ion batteries is relatively expensive compared to traditional lead-acid batteries. The cost of raw materials, such as lithium and cobalt, can also be volatile.
  • Temperature Sensitivity: Lithium-ion batteries can be sensitive to temperature extremes. High temperatures can lead to reduced lifespan, while low temperatures can affect their performance.
  • Environmental Concerns: The mining and processing of lithium can have environmental impacts, and improper disposal of lithium-ion batteries can lead to pollution and increased waste.

Applications of Lithium-Ion Batteries

Lithium-ion batteries have permeated various sectors, showcasing their versatility and reliability. Some key applications include:

1. Consumer Electronics

From smartphones and laptops to tablets and wearable devices, lithium-ion batteries are the backbone of portable electronics. Their lightweight nature allows these devices to remain compact and user-friendly.

2. Electric Vehicles (EVs)

The automotive industry has embraced lithium-ion battery technology with open arms. EVs rely heavily on these batteries for efficient energy storage, providing longer driving ranges and faster charging times compared to traditional batteries.

3. Renewable Energy Storage

As the world shifts towards renewable energy sources like solar and wind, the need for efficient energy storage solutions becomes paramount. Lithium-ion batteries are increasingly being used to store surplus energy generated by renewable sources, ensuring a stable energy supply during low-production periods.

4. Medical Devices

In the medical field, lithium-ion batteries can be found in a variety of devices, from portable imaging equipment to pacemakers. Their reliability and long-lasting power make them an excellent choice for critical applications that require consistent performance.

The Future of Lithium-Ion Technology

As demand for energy storage continues to grow, research and development in lithium-ion battery technology is more crucial than ever. Some key trends and innovations to watch include:

1. Solid-State Batteries

Researchers are exploring solid-state batteries, which replace the liquid electrolyte with a solid electrolyte. This technology could provide improved safety and higher energy density while reducing the risk of overheating and fires associated with traditional lithium-ion batteries.

2. Recycling and Sustainability

With environmental concerns on the rise, recycling lithium-ion batteries is becoming increasingly important. Enhanced recycling processes will not only mitigate waste but also recover valuable materials, reducing the need for new mining operations.

3. Increased Energy Density

Ongoing research aims to boost the energy density of lithium-ion batteries, enabling the creation of more compact and efficient energy storage solutions, particularly for electric vehicles and renewable energy systems.
